The book "Advances in Extended and Multifield Theories for Continua" offers a comprehensive analysis of modern computational techniques, particularly the finite element method, and their application in science and technology. It highlights the necessity of going beyond traditional Cauchy-Boltzmann continuum theories to account for material properties arising from microstructural phenomena. Inhomogeneous loading and deformation states require a deeper understanding of lower scales, as these effects can influence the macroscopic material response. The book argues that standard continuum mechanics must be expanded to capture these complex phenomena and make this information accessible for macroscopic numerical simulations. It is aimed at professionals and students engaged with the latest developments in continuum theory and its practical applications.
